📢 Zimbabwe 2025 Telegram Advertising Landscape

Telegram’s traction in Zimbabwe is no joke. With over 2 million active users locally (source: 2025 May stats), it’s a prime spot for brands to reach youth, entrepreneurs, and even rural communities who are now smartphone-savvy thanks to affordable data bundles.

Unlike Facebook, Telegram channels and groups are less saturated with ads but highly engaged. Popular local Telegram channels like ZimDeals, Harare News Update, and Mbare Market Buzz command serious attention, each boasting subscriber counts from 50,000 to over 150,000.

Advertisers have three main ad formats on Telegram Zimbabwe:

  • Sponsored Messages in Channels: Pin your promo in a popular channel.
  • Bot-Driven Ads: Interactive ads via Telegram bots.
  • Group Promotions: Partner with group admins for shoutouts.

Understanding this mix helps you craft a media plan that balances reach and engagement.

💰 2025 Zimbabwe Telegram Advertising Rates Breakdown

Here’s the lowdown on typical advertising rates advertisers should expect on Telegram Zimbabwe in 2025:

Ad Type Rate per Post (ZWL) Notes
Sponsored Channel Post ZWL 15,000 – ZWL 40,000 Depends on channel size & engagement
Bot Interaction Ads ZWL 10,000 – ZWL 25,000 For interactive campaigns
Group Shoutouts ZWL 5,000 – ZWL 15,000 Smaller groups cost less

Rates fluctuate depending on channel niche, subscriber quality, and timing. For example, ZimFashion Hub, a top fashion Telegram channel, charges closer to the upper bracket due to their loyal urban female audience.

Keep in mind, Zimbabwe’s inflation and currency fluctuations mean rates in ZWL can shift monthly. Some channels peg their rates in USD equivalents to lock in value, payable via Ecocash or bank transfer.

💡 Media Planning Tips for Zimbabwe Advertisers on Telegram

If you’re coming from Vietnam or any other market and want to run online promotion here, understand Zimbabwe’s local flavour:

  • Leverage Ecocash: Most digital payments flow through Ecocash wallets. Ensure your influencers or channel admins accept Ecocash for smooth transactions.
  • Localise Content: Zimbabweans respond better to ads with Shona or Ndebele slang mixed in. Throw in local references — no stiff corporate talk.
  • Mix Channels: Don’t put all your eggs in one Telegram basket. Combine a few mid-sized channels with niche groups to diversify reach.
  • Respect Legal Boundaries: Zimbabwe’s Advertising Standards Authority (ASA) monitors ads for false claims, especially in health and finance. Keep your promos clean and verified.
  • Track Engagement: Use Telegram’s built-in analytics or third-party tools to monitor views and interactions, adjusting your media plan on the fly.

❗ Risks and Considerations

Watch out for:

  • Fake Channels: Some Telegram channels inflate subscriber numbers to charge premium rates. Vet channels carefully.
  • Payment Scams: Always use trusted payment platforms like Ecocash. Avoid upfront cash deals without contracts.
  • Ad Fatigue: Overloading one channel with ads can irritate subscribers, hurting brand image.
